Introduction
� Bursa Malaysia (MYX: 1818) is an exchange holding
company approved under Section 15 of the Capital
Markets and Services Act 2007. It operates a fully-
integrated exchange, offering the complete range of exchange-related services including trading, clearing,
settlement and depository services.

Structure
The wholly-owned subsidiaries of Bursa Malaysia own and operate the variousbusinesses, as set out below:-
� Bursa Malaysia Securities Bhd - Provide, operate and maintain securitiesexchange
� Bursa Malaysia Derivatives Bhd - Provide, operate and maintain a futuresand options exchange
� Labuan International Financial Exchange Inc. - Provide, operate and maintainoffshore financial exchange
� Bursa Malaysia Bonds Sdn Bhd - Provide, operate and maintain registeredelectronic facility for secondary bond market
� Bursa Malaysia Securities Clearing Sdn Bhd - Provide, operate and maintaina clearing house for the securities exchange
� Bursa Malaysia Derivatives Clearing Bhd - Provide, operate and maintain aclearing house for the futures and options exchange
� Bursa Malaysia Depository Sdn Bhd - Provide, operate and maintain a centraldepository
� Bursa Malaysia Depository Nominees Sdn Bhd - Act as a nominee for thecentral depository and receive securities on deposit for safe-custody or management

Palm Oil Features
� Bursa Malaysia is the world's biggest palm oilfutures trading hub since 1980. The FCPO,the global price benchmark for the crude palm
oil market, is a deliverable contract which istraded electronically on Bursa Malaysia¶strading platform.
� Crude palm kernel futures and crude palm oil
futures are primarily traded on Bursa Malaysiain Malaysian Ringgit (MYR) and US dollar denominated contracts. Their codenames areFPKO, FCPO and FUPO, respectively.
